摘要 An object of the present invention is to provide a liquid-crystal display element using a liquid-crystal composition having negative dielectric anisotropy, capable of realizing excellent display characteristics by being used in a liquid-crystal display element provided with a photo-alignment film, without deteriorating various characteristics as a liquid-crystal display element such as dielectric anisotropy, viscosity, a nematic phase upper limit temperature, nematic phase stability at low temperatures, and γ1, and burn-in characteristics of a display element. A liquid-crystal display element using a liquid-crystal composition containing at least one compound selected from the group consisting of compounds represented by the following General Formula (I) is provided.;

A liquid-crystal display element, comprising: a first substrate and a second substrate disposed to face each other; a liquid-crystal layer containing a liquid-crystal composition with which the gap between the first substrate and the second substrate is filled; an electrode layer including a common electrode including a transparent conductive material, a plurality of gate bus lines and data bus lines disposed in a matrix shape, a thin film transistor provided at the intersection at which the gate bus lines and the data bus lines intersect each other, and a pixel electrode including a transparent conductive material and forming an electric field between the common electrode and the pixel electrode by being driven by the thin film transistor, for each pixel on the first substrate; and photo-alignment film layers which are formed between the liquid-crystal layer and the first substrate and between the liquid-crystal layer and the second substrate, respectively, wherein the liquid-crystal composition has negative dielectric anisotropy, a nematic phase-isotropic liquid transition temperature of equal to or higher than 60° C., and an absolute value of the dielectric anisotropy of equal to or greater than 2, and contains at least one compound selected from the group consisting of compounds represented by the following General Formula (I): wherein each of R1 and R2 independently represents an alkyl group having 1 to 8 carbon atoms, an alkenyl group having 2 to 8 carbon atoms, an alkoxy group having 1 to 8 carbon atoms, or an alkenyloxy group having 2 to 8 carbon atoms, A represents a 1,4-phenylene group or a trans-1,4-cyclohexylene group, k represents 1 or 2, and in a case where k is 2, two A's may be the same as or different from each other.
